Well, almost :-). Some things could not be done cleanly while staying within MPI-3. For example, when you do a wildcard receive, it will always return an error if any process in the communicator is dead. The MPI Forum is working on fixing this by allowing the user to "opt in" for this wildcard stuff. I'm a few months behind on the MPI-3.1 fault-tolerance proposal, but I believe this is still present. -- Pavan -- Pavan Balaji http://www.mcs.anl.gov/~balaji
